Childcare Fraud Bills See Updates From Ohio Legislature
A bill introduced in the Ohio General Assembly earlier this year is seeing changes as lawmakers craft how to deal with concerns about childcare centers.
In January, Republican state Reps. Josh Williams and DJ Swearingen introduced House Bill 649, with the House Children and Human Services Committee continuing to review the bill.
The bill requires the Ohio Department of Children and Youth to immediately conduct a preliminary investigation following an allegation of waste, fraud, or abuse at childcare centers receiving public funding in the state.
When introducing the bill, Williams promoted standardized enforcement so “no one can complain about the oversight because it’s a uniform rule by the Legislature across the state of Ohio.”
The Childcare Fraud Prevention Act, Williams said, came in response “to an overwhelming request for better oversight of our publicly funded childcare system in Ohio.”
